M&S stores in Paris RUN OUT of sandwiches and other lunch items


Marks & Spencer stores in Paris are experiencing a takeaway lunch shortage - which the retailer blames on delays to fresh food imports from the UK due to Brexit. Many M&S sandwiches are made by the ready meal giant Greencore, which has a plant in Northampton. At the M&S store in a shopping centre in the Porte Maillot district of western Paris, fresh salads were out of stock. At a third branch, on Boulevard Montmartre in central Paris, shelves of ready-to-eat fresh food were empty.
